Your first decision is between covered and uncovered storage. Given Georgia's famous summer sun and sudden thunderstorms, a covered space is highly recommended to protect your boat's gel coat, upholstery, and electronics from UV damage and water intrusion. For maximum protection, especially during winter, consider an enclosed, climate-controlled unit. While our winters are generally mild, a few freezing nights can be hard on your engine's block and plumbing systems. A climate-controlled environment in a local facility provides stable temperatures and low humidity, which is ideal for preventing mold and mildew.
Location is key for convenience. Look for storage facilities with easy access to major routes like I-285, I-85, and US-78, simplifying your trip to the boat ramp. Many storage providers in the Decatur, Stone Mountain, and Tucker areas also offer valuable amenities like 24/7 security access, on-site dump stations, and even wash bays. Before you commit, always visit the facility in person. Check the fencing, lighting, and gate security. Ask about their specific policies regarding maintenance work on-site and how they handle trailer parking.
Don't forget to prepare your boat properly, no matter where you store it. For our climate, a thorough cleaning to remove Georgia clay and lake water, a solid fogging of the engine, and a quality breathable cover are non-negotiable steps. Using a professional storage service often includes these prep steps, giving you peace of mind. Finally, think about your usage pattern. If you're a year-round boater, a facility with simple in-and-out access is perfect. If you mostly boat from spring to fall, you might opt for a seasonal contract to save money during the off-months.
